Explorar os diferentes tipos de alertas suportados pelo Azure Monitor

Concluído

O Azure Monitor é uma ferramenta avançada de relatórios e análises. Você pode usá-lo para obter informações sobre o comportamento e a execução de seu ambiente e aplicativos. Em seguida, poderá responder proativamente a falhas no seu sistema.

Depois do tempo de inatividade enfrentado pelos seus clientes, configurou a monitorização nos seus principais recursos no Azure. Com o monitoramento em vigor, você quer ter certeza de que as pessoas certas estão sendo alertadas no nível certo.

Nesta unidade, você aprenderá como o Azure Monitor recebe dados de recursos, o que compõe um alerta e como e quando usar um alerta. Finalmente, você aprende a criar e gerenciar seus próprios alertas.

Tipos de dados no Azure Monitor

O Azure Monitor recebe dados de recursos de destino, tal como aplicações, sistemas operativos, recursos do Azure, subscrições do Azure e inquilinos do Azure. A natureza do recurso define quais os tipos de dados que estão disponíveis. Um tipo de dados pode ser uma métrica, um log ou uma métrica e um log:

  • O foco dos tipos de dados baseados em métricas são os valores numéricos sensíveis ao tempo, que representam um determinado aspeto do recurso de destino.
  • O foco dos tipos de dados baseados em registos é a consulta de dados de conteúdos mantidos em ficheiros de registo estruturados e baseados em registos que são relevantes para o recurso de destino.

Diagrama que representa os recursos de destino que alimentam o Azure Monitor e os dois tipos de sinal principais: métricas e logs.

Há três tipos de sinal que você pode usar para monitorar seu ambiente:

  • Os alertas de métricas fornecem um acionador de alerta quando um limiar especificado é excedido. Por exemplo, um alerta de métricas pode notificá-lo quando a utilização da CPU for superior a 95%.
  • Os alertas do registo de atividades enviam-lhe uma notificação quando os recursos do Azure mudam de estado. Por exemplo, um alerta do registo de atividades pode notificá-lo quando um recurso for eliminado.
  • Os alertas de registo baseiam-se nos conteúdos gravados nos ficheiros de registo. Por exemplo, um alerta de pesquisa de log pode notificá-lo quando um servidor Web retorna um número específico de 404 ou 500 respostas.

Composição de uma regra de alerta

Cada alerta ou notificação disponível no Azure Monitor é o produto de uma regra. Algumas destas regras são criadas na plataforma do Azure. Você pode usar regras de alerta para criar alertas e notificações personalizados. A composição de uma regra de alerta permanece igual, independentemente do recurso de destino ou da origem de dados que utiliza.

  • RECURSO
    • O recurso de destino para a regra de alerta. Você pode atribuir vários recursos de destino a uma única regra de alerta. O tipo de recurso define os tipos de sinal disponíveis.
  • CONDIÇÃO
    • O tipo de sinal usado para avaliar a regra. O tipo de sinal pode ser de métrica, registo de atividades ou registos. Existem outros, mas este módulo não os aborda.
    • A lógica de alerta aplicada aos dados que estão sendo fornecidos através do tipo de sinal. A estrutura da lógica de alerta muda dependendo do tipo de sinal.
  • AÇÕES
    • A ação, como enviar um e-mail, enviar uma mensagem SMS (Short Message Service) ou usar um webhook.
    • Um grupo de ações, que normalmente contém um conjunto exclusivo de destinatários para a ação.
  • DETALHES DO ALERTA
    • Um nome de alerta e uma descrição de alerta que especificam a finalidade do alerta.
    • A gravidade do alerta se os critérios ou o teste lógico obtiverem uma avaliação true. Os cinco níveis de gravidade são:
      • 0: Crítica
      • 1: Erro
      • 2: Advertência
      • 3: Informativo
      • 4: Verbose

Captura de ecrã da página Criar regra no portal do Azure Monitor.

Âmbito das regras de alertas

Você pode obter dados de monitoramento da maioria dos serviços do Azure e gerar relatórios sobre eles usando o pipeline do Azure Monitor. No pipeline do Azure Monitor, pode criar regras de alertas para esses itens e mais:

  • Valores de métricas
  • Consultas de pesquisa de registos
  • Eventos de registo de atividades
  • Estado de funcionamento da plataforma subjacente do Azure
  • Testes de disponibilidade do site

Gerir regras de alerta

Nem todas as regras de alertas que cria precisam de ser executadas para sempre. Com o Azure Monitor, pode especificar uma ou mais regras de alertas e ativá-las ou desativá-las conforme necessário.

Como arquiteto de soluções do Azure, você deseja usar o Azure Monitor para habilitar alertas específicos e bem focados antes de qualquer alteração no aplicativo. Em seguida, desative os alertas após uma implantação bem-sucedida.

Vista de resumo do alerta

A página de alerta mostra um resumo de todos os alertas. Você pode aplicar filtros ao modo de exibição usando uma ou mais das seguintes categorias: assinaturas, condição de alerta, gravidade ou intervalos de tempo. A vista inclui apenas os alertas que correspondem a estes critérios.

Captura de ecrã da página de alertas do Azure Monitor no portal do Azure Monitor.

Condição de alerta

O sistema define a condição de alerta.

  • Quando um alerta é acionado, a condição do monitor do alerta é definida como Acionado.
  • Depois que a condição subjacente que causou o disparo do alerta for limpa, a condição do monitor será definida como Resolvida.
1.

Qual é a composição de uma regra de alerta?

2.

Qual dos exemplos a seguir descreve um tipo de dados de log?